Transaction 90a63cfaa1007805cfa3df669ef3db1b20b3e17037cc1986d519a3efafdbe299

1 Input
2 Outputs
  • 90a63cfaa1007805cfa3df669ef3db1b20b3e17037cc1986d519a3efafdbe299:0
  • value  137534
    address  bc1qrh2sqcuefjqw50qdu396dqhppzsday8zwl73x5
  • 90a63cfaa1007805cfa3df669ef3db1b20b3e17037cc1986d519a3efafdbe299:1
  • value  28410897
    address  3QYmEZmsFZLRcFLFGwewYM6iaG24xb8gj5